Home
last modified time | relevance | path

Searched refs:qdep (Results 1 – 5 of 5) sorted by relevance

/linux/drivers/iommu/intel/
H A Diommu.h419 #define QI_DEV_IOTLB_QDEP(qdep) (((qdep) & 0x1f) << 16) argument
1047 static inline void qi_desc_dev_iotlb(u16 sid, u16 pfsid, u16 qdep, u64 addr, in qi_desc_dev_iotlb() argument
1057 if (qdep >= QI_DEV_IOTLB_MAX_INVS) in qi_desc_dev_iotlb()
1058 qdep = 0; in qi_desc_dev_iotlb()
1060 desc->qw0 = QI_DEV_IOTLB_SID(sid) | QI_DEV_IOTLB_QDEP(qdep) | in qi_desc_dev_iotlb()
1094 u16 qdep, u64 addr, in qi_desc_dev_iotlb_pasid() argument
1101 QI_DEV_EIOTLB_QDEP(qdep) | QI_DEIOTLB_TYPE | in qi_desc_dev_iotlb_pasid()
1150 u16 qdep, u64 addr, unsigned mask);
1156 u32 pasid, u16 qdep, u64 addr,
1160 u32 pasid, u16 qdep);
H A Dcache.c319 u16 qdep, u64 addr, unsigned int mask, in qi_batch_add_dev_iotlb() argument
329 qi_desc_dev_iotlb(sid, pfsid, qdep, addr, mask, &batch->descs[batch->index]); in qi_batch_add_dev_iotlb()
350 u32 pasid, u16 qdep, u64 addr, in qi_batch_add_pasid_dev_iotlb() argument
361 qi_desc_dev_iotlb_pasid(sid, pfsid, pasid, qdep, addr, size_order, in qi_batch_add_pasid_dev_iotlb()
H A Dpasid.c215 u16 sid, qdep, pfsid; in devtlb_invalidation_with_pasid() local
225 qdep = info->ats_qdep; in devtlb_invalidation_with_pasid()
235 qi_flush_dev_iotlb(iommu, sid, pfsid, qdep, 0, 64 - VTD_PAGE_SHIFT); in devtlb_invalidation_with_pasid()
237 qi_flush_dev_iotlb_pasid(iommu, sid, pfsid, pasid, qdep, 0, 64 - VTD_PAGE_SHIFT); in devtlb_invalidation_with_pasid()
H A Ddmar.c1537 u16 qdep, u64 addr, unsigned mask) in qi_flush_dev_iotlb() argument
1550 qi_desc_dev_iotlb(sid, pfsid, qdep, addr, mask, &desc); in qi_flush_dev_iotlb()
1576 u32 pasid, u16 qdep, u64 addr, unsigned int size_order) in qi_flush_dev_iotlb_pasid() argument
1590 qdep, addr, size_order, in qi_flush_dev_iotlb_pasid()
H A Diommu.c4149 u32 pasid, u16 qdep) in quirk_extra_dev_tlb_flush() argument
4159 qdep, address, mask); in quirk_extra_dev_tlb_flush()
4162 pasid, qdep, address, mask); in quirk_extra_dev_tlb_flush()